Brad excels at providing context and perspective to the results of complex sites and synthesizing this information to provide practical, innovative, and focused recommendations. His broad and deep technical expertise includes subsurface hydrogeologic assessments, contaminant fate and transport modeling, vapor intrusion investigation and mitigation, risk assessment, and screening and implementation of remedial alternatives. Brad is a geologist with an undergraduate degree from Wheaton College (IL), and a master’s degree with a hydrogeology focus from Western Michigan University.
